User Maintenance Instructions (cont.)

10. Do not remove the White lubricant on

the gears and Motor Assembly. The
lubricant is used to reduce the friction
and noise of the gears. Removal of the
lubricant will reduce the cutting
performance and increase the operating
noise. If the lubricant has been removed,
a thin film of margarine or food-grade
lubricant may be applied. Never apply
industrial-use or automotive-use
lubricants as they may not be safe for
consumption and may damage the gears.

11. Any servicing requiring disassembly other than the above cleaning

must be performed by a qualified appliance repair technician. 

Helpful Hints

The Food Slicer can be used to cut meat, cheese, vegetables or bread.
1.

Roasts:

Beef, pork, poultry and lamb -- Allow roasts to stand for

20 minutes after removing from the oven before slicing.

2.

Bulk Bacon:

With a sharp knife, remove the rind from

"thoroughly chilled" bacon. Trim bacon to fit securely on Feeder,
fat side down.

3.

Cheese and cold cuts:

Slice as needed to retain flavor. Remove

the plastic or hard casing from "well chilled" food before slicing.
Use gentle pressure for uniform slices.

4.

When you are going to slice very thin food, unplug the unit and
moisten the Blade with a damp cloth; this helps to prevent
sticking. If cheese builds up on the Blade or under the Blade
Cover, unplug the slicer and wipe the Blade clean with a damp
cloth.

5.

When slicing food that is not uniform in size, always slice with the
largest side first.

6.

Vegetables and fruits: 

Slice potatoes, tomatoes, carrots,

cucumbers, cabbage, lettuce, eggplant, squash and zucchini in a
matter of minutes.

7.

Breads: 

Do not use excessive pressure or squeeze the loaf. Trim

or cut bread to fit comfortably on the Feeder. Move the loaf of
bread smoothly through the blade with continuous "gentle"
pressure on the loaf.
